There are 5/6 as many black pants as blue pants in george's closet. There are 5/9 as many black pants as brown pants in his closet. What is the ratio of the number black pants to the total number of pants in his closet?

Answers

Answer is the ratio   1 : 4

Work Shown

x = number of black pants

y = number of blue pants

z = number of brown pants

x = (5/6)y

x = (5/9)z

z = (9/5)x

x+y+z = total number of pants

x+y+z = (5/6)y + y + (9/5)x

x+y+z = (5/6)y+y+(9/5)*(5/6)y  

x+y+z = (5/6)y+y+(3/2)y

x+y+z = (5/6)y+(6/6)y+(9/6)y

x+y+z = ( (5+6+9)/6 )y

x+y+z = (20/6)y

x+y+z = (10/3)y

numberOfBlackPants : Total

(5/6)y : (10/3)y

6*(5/6)y : 6*(10/3)y

5y : 20y

5 : 20

1 : 4

The ratio of the number of black pants to the total number is 1 : 4

It means the total is 4 times that of the number of black pants.

Find an equation in standard form for the ellipse with the vertical major axis of length 6 and minor axis of length 4

Answers

Answer:

  x^2/4 +y^2/9 = 1

Step-by-step explanation:

The standard form is ...

  (x -h)^2/a^2 +(y -k)^2/b^2 = 1

for an ellipse centered at (h, k) with semi-axis measures "a" and "b". The largest of "a" or "b" is the semi-major axis; the smaller, the semi-minor axis.

Here, the major axis is vertical, so b > a.

Since the center is not given, we assume it is the origin: h = k = 0. The semi-axes are a=2, b=3, so the equation is ...

  x^2/4 +y^2/9 = 1
